Basic Concept
Quantum computing is based on principles of quantum mechanics, a branch of physics that studies very small particles like atoms and electrons. Unlike classical computers that use bits (0 or 1), quantum computers use qubits.
Key features include:
- Qubits can be both 0 and 1 at the same time
- This property is called superposition
- Qubits can also be linked through entanglement
- These features allow massive parallel computation
Quantum computers can process complex problems much faster than traditional systems.
How It Works
Quantum computers operate using quantum states and probabilities rather than fixed values. This allows them to explore many possible solutions simultaneously.
Key working principles:
- Superposition allows multiple states at once
- Entanglement connects qubits for coordinated computation
- Quantum gates manipulate qubit states
- Measurement collapses the quantum state into a result
This unique working method enables powerful computational capabilities.

Skills Required
To understand quantum computing, students need a combination of technical and analytical skills.
Important skills include:
- Strong mathematics (especially algebra and probability)
- Basic understanding of physics
- Programming knowledge (Python, Qiskit)
- Logical and problem-solving skills
Developing these skills can help students succeed in this field.
